What Is Pain O Soma?

Pain O Soma is a product containing carisoprodol. It is used as part of treatment for acute, painful musculoskeletal conditions in adults, generally alongside rest, physical therapy, and other appropriate measures.

Current U.S. labeling recommends limiting carisoprodol treatment to two or three weeks.

Because carisoprodol is a prescription medicine, patients should consult a qualified healthcare professional before using it.

5. Check the Exact Strength

The strength listed online should correspond with your prescription.

For example, Pain O Soma 350 mg contains carisoprodol 350 mg. Current U.S. SOMA labeling includes 350 mg tablets as well as 250 mg tablets.

Do not increase, decrease, or change your prescribed strength based on an online product listing.

Be Careful With Pain O Soma 500 mg

Some websites advertise Pain O Soma 500 mg, but current U.S. SOMA labeling does not list a standard 500 mg tablet; it lists 250 mg and 350 mg tablets.

If you encounter a 500 mg listing, carefully verify the manufacturer, labeling, intended market, and regulatory information before considering the product.

9. Understand Carisoprodol Safety

Before placing an order, make sure you understand the medicine itself.

Carisoprodol can cause drowsiness, dizziness, and headache. Its sedative effects may affect your ability to drive or operate machinery.

Alcohol and other central nervous system depressants can increase sedative effects. Carisoprodol also carries risks related to abuse, dependence, withdrawal, and seizures.

Use the medicine only according to your healthcare professional's instructions.

10. Consider the Treatment Duration

Carisoprodol is intended for short-term use.

Current U.S. labeling recommends treatment for two or three weeks. Longer treatment should not be continued on your own simply because symptoms remain.

If pain, stiffness, or muscle-related symptoms continue, speak with a healthcare professional for further evaluation.
